•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

DüşeyAra Destek

  • Konbuyu başlatan Konbuyu başlatan Mikdad
  • Başlangıç tarihi Başlangıç tarihi

Mikdad

Altın Üye
Katılım
5 Ocak 2006
Mesajlar
333
Excel Vers. ve Dili
365 Türkçe
Selamun Aleykum doslarım,
=EĞERHATA(DÜŞEYARA(P2;Personel!A:C;3;YANLIŞ);"Kayıt Bulunamadı")

ben bu formul ile gerekli karşılaştırmayı yapıp Personel Sayfasındaki 3. satırı getirtebiliyorum.
ama formulu yazdığım Rapor sayfasında eğer AB sutununda Personel Görüşü yazıyorsa bu formulun boş değer vermesini istiyorum. nasıl bir değişiklik yabilirim acaba
 
Merhaba.
Öncelikle; profilinizde, kullandığınız MsExcel versiyon ve dilini belirtmenizde yarar olduğunu hatırlatayım.
Çünkü bunlar, sorduğunuz sorulara verilecek cevapları etkileyebilecek bilgiler.

Sorunuza gelince; mevcut formülü =EĞER(AB2="";""; mevcut formülünüz ) şeklinde değiştirerek sonuç alabilirsiniz.
.
 
Merhaba.
Öncelikle; profilinizde, kullandığınız MsExcel versiyon ve dilini belirtmenizde yarar olduğunu hatırlatayım.
Çünkü bunlar, sorduğunuz sorulara verilecek cevapları etkileyebilecek bilgiler.
Sorunuza gelince; mevcut formülü =EĞER(AB2="";""; mevcut formülünüz ) şeklinde değiştirerek sonuç alabilirsiniz.
.
Değerli Hocam,
Yüreğinize Sağlık Teşekkür Ederim. işime yaradı,
 
Selamun Aleykum Dostlarım,
=EĞER(E2="";"";EĞER(ESAYIYSA(MBUL(" 99"; E2)); "SURİYELİ";EĞER(AC2=" Personel Görüşünün karar olarak kabulune";""; EĞERHATA(DÜŞEYARA(Q2;Personel!A:C;3;YANLIŞ);"Kayıt Bulunamadı") )))
Şeklinde bir kodum var.
u şekilde bir kodum var. MBUL kısmında MBUL kısmında tc eğer 99 ile başlıyorsa karşısına suriyeli yazıyor. benim istediğim önce tc ye bakacak eğer 99 ile başlıyorsa bu seferde Q sutununa bakacak eğer GÖLCÜK MAH. YAZIYORSA emrullah suriyeli yazacak, eğer CUMHURİYET MAH. yazıyorsa Mert Suriyeli yazacak ve eğer SEYİTLER MAH. yazıyorsa Uğur Suriyeli yazacak ve kodun geri kalanı çalışacak.

Yardımcı Olursanız çok sevinirim.
 

Ekli dosyalar

Aleyküm Selam
AB2 hücresi için formülü değiştiriniz.
Kod:
=EĞER(E2="";"";EĞER(ESAYIYSA(MBUL(" 99"; E2)); ARA(Q2;{"CUMHURİYET MAH.";"GÖLCÜK MAH.";"SEYİTLER MAH."};{"Mert Suriyeli";"Emrullah Suriyeli";"Uğur Suriyeli"});EĞER(AC2=" Personel Görüşünün karar olarak kabulune";"";EĞERHATA(DÜŞEYARA(Q2;Personel!A:C;3;YANLIŞ);"Kayıt Bulunamadı"))))
 
Aleyküm Selam
AB2 hücresi için formülü değiştiriniz.
Kod:
=EĞER(E2="";"";EĞER(ESAYIYSA(MBUL(" 99"; E2)); ARA(Q2;{"CUMHURİYET MAH.";"GÖLCÜK MAH.";"SEYİTLER MAH."};{"Mert Suriyeli";"Emrullah Suriyeli";"Uğur Suriyeli"});EĞER(AC2=" Personel Görüşünün karar olarak kabulune";"";EĞERHATA(DÜŞEYARA(Q2;Personel!A:C;3;YANLIŞ);"Kayıt Bulunamadı"))))
Hocam bu kod ile sadece cumhuriyet gölcük ve seyitler mahallesini gördügünde karşısına suriyeli yazması lazım ama suan hangi mahalle olujrsa olsun tc yi 99 ile baslatırsam direk suriyeli diye suriyeli diye yazoıyor
 
Merhaba dener misiniz?
Kod:
=EĞER(E2="";"";EĞER(VE(ESAYIYSA(MBUL(" 99"; E2)); EĞERHATA(ARA(Q2;{"CUMHURİYET MAH.";"GÖLCÜK MAH.";"SEYİTLER MAH."})=Q2;YANLIŞ));ARA(Q2;{"CUMHURİYET MAH.";"GÖLCÜK MAH.";"SEYİTLER MAH."};{"Mert Suriyeli";"Emrullah Suriyeli";"Uğur Suriyeli"});EĞER(AC2=" Personel Görüşünün karar olarak kabulune";""; EĞERHATA(DÜŞEYARA(Q2;Personel!A:C;3;YANLIŞ);"Kayıt Bulunamadı"))))
 
Geri
Üst